Baked Shrimp Scampi
Prep Time10 Minutes
Servings4
Cook Time12 Minutes
Calories348
Ingredients
1 lb Bowl & Basket Raw Shrimp Cleaned & Tail-On Large
2 Tbs olive oil
1 Tbs dry white wine (or 1½ teaspoons each fresh lemon juice and water)
2 garlic cloves, minced
1 Roma tomato, chopped
1 small shallot, finely chopped
1 Tbs tablespoon fresh lemon juice + 1/2 tsp lemon zest
1 Tbs dried Italian seasoning
17.6 oz ready to serve red quinoa & brown rice
Directions

1. Preheat oven to 425°. Spray 2-quart baking dish with cooking spray. In medium bowl, toss shrimp, 1 tablespoon oil and wine; let stand 10 minutes.

 

2. In medium bowl, stir garlic, tomato, shallot, lemon juice, seasoning, lemon zest, remaining 1 tablespoon oil, 1/8 teaspoon salt and ¼ teaspoon pepper.

 

3. Transfer shrimp to prepared dish; top with tomato mixture. Bake 12 minutes or until shrimp turn opaque throughout and internal temperature reaches 145°.

 

4. Cook rice as label directs; serve shrimp scampi over quinoa and brown rice.

 

Nutritional Information
  • 11 g Total Fat
  • 1 g Saturated Fat
  • 195 mg Cholesterol
  • 550 mg Sodium
  • 37 g Carbohydrates
  • 7 g Fiber
  • 1 g Sugars
  • 31 g Protein
